Understanding the Mechanics and Randomness

At the heart of Aviator, and countless other online casino games, is a Random Number Generator (RNG). This is a complex algorithm designed to produce unpredictable results, ensuring fairness and preventing manipulation. The RNG isn’t something you can ‘hack’ in the traditional sense; it’s the very foundation of the game's integrity. Attempts to predict the outcome based on past flights are often flawed, falling prey to the gambler’s fallacy – the mistaken belief that if something happens more frequently during a period, it will happen less frequently in the future (or vice versa). The game’s design intentionally avoids any predictable patterns; each flight is an independent event.

However, that doesn’t mean all approaches are equally ineffective. While you can’t predict when the plane will crash, you can manage your risk and maximize your potential returns. This involves understanding the concept of volatility and adjusting your betting strategy accordingly. Higher volatility means larger potential payouts, but also a greater risk of loss. Lower volatility offers more frequent, smaller wins. Choosing the right strategy depends on your risk tolerance and financial goals. The Role of Provably Fair Technology

Many Aviator platforms incorporate “provably fair” technology, allowing players to verify the randomness of each game round. This is achieved through cryptographic hashing and seed values. Players can independently confirm that the results were not predetermined by the operator, fostering trust and transparency. Understanding how provably fair systems work can alleviate concerns about manipulation, although it doesn't offer a predictive advantage. It simply confirms the integrity of the game.

The Martingale and Reverse Martingale Strategies

The Martingale strategy invol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the idea that eventually, you’ll win back your losses plus a small profit. While theoretically sound, the Martingale strategy requires a substantial bankroll and can quickly become unsustainable due to betting limits imposed by the platform. The Reverse Martingale strategy, conversely, involves increasing your bet after each win and decreasing it after each loss. This strategy is less risky than the Martingale, but still requires discipline and caution.

It’s important to remember that neither the Martingale nor the Reverse Martingale strategy guarantees profits. They are simply betting systems that can potentially alter your risk profile. Both strategies are susceptible to losing streaks and require a well-funded bankroll to withstand potential setbacks. The Illusion of Prediction Tools and Bots

The internet is rife with claims of “aviator predictor hack” tools and bots that promise to accurately predict when the plane will crash. These claims are almost always fraudulent. The core principle of the game – the RNG – makes it impossible to predict the outcome with certainty. These tools often mimic legitimate trading platforms, but in reality, they are designed to steal your login credentials, install malware, or simply take your money. Be extremely cautious of anyone selling such software or guaranteeing profits.

Many of these so-called prediction tools rely on flawed algorithms that analyze historical data, attempting to identify patterns that simply don't exist. The RNG ensures that each round is independent of the previous ones, rendering any attempts to extrapolate future outcomes based on past results fundamentally inaccurate. Furthermore, even if a tool were to occasionally show some apparent success, it would likely be due to sheer luck, not genuine predictive ability. Identifying Scam Indicators

There are several red flags to watch out for when encountering claims of “aviator predictor hack” software. These include unrealistic profit guarantees, pressure to act quickly, requests for upfront fees, and a lack of transparency regarding the tool’s underlying technology. Reputable software developers will never make such guarantees or employ manipulative sales tactics. Always research the developer and read reviews from other users before considering any purchase. If something seems too good to be true, it almost certainly is.

Another common scam involves phishing websites that mimic the appearance of legitimate Aviator platforms. These websites are designed to steal your login credentials. Always double-check the URL and ensure you are visiting the official website of the platform you intend to play on. Enable two-factor authentication for added security and be wary of unsolicited emails or messages offering access to prediction tools or exclusive bonuses.

The Psychological Aspects of Aviator Gameplay

Aviator, like many gambling games, can be highly addictive. The fast-paced nature of the game, coupled with the potential for quick wins, can trigger a dopamine rush in the brain, creating a sense of excitement and reward. This can lead to compulsive behavior and excessive gambling. It’s important to be aware of these psychological effects and to practice responsible gambling habits. Recognizing the signs of problem gambling, such as chasing losses, gambling with money you can’t afford to lose, and lying to others about your gambling activities, is the first step towards seeking help.

The illusion of control is another psychological factor that can contribute to problem gambling. Players may believe they have some degree of control over the outcome of the game, even though it’s entirely based on chance. This belief can lead them to take unnecessary risks and to gamble beyond their means. It’s crucial to remember that Aviator is a game of luck, and there is no skill involved in predicting when the plane will crash. Accepting this fact is essential for maintaining a healthy perspective and avoiding compulsive behavior.
